When reading the whole thing I see that Arizona Game and Fish is not recommending a ban on lead in hunting and fishing products, just caution about this petition from an environmental group. Here is one of AZGFD's statements,"The Department is not pursuing a recommendation to regulate or ban lead for use in hunting ammunition or fishing tackle."
Tree huggers are pushing for a lead ban based on an old study of California Condors, one that resulted in CA taking drastic action on lead use ammunition. As I see it, this sparked an idea in the anti-gun crowd that they could ban folks from making their own ammunition (i.e. reloaders) by banning lead use in ammo. You can't control ammo availability as long as people have the means to make their own. As I see it just another step in ultimately banning guns. If the ammo is controlled, made ridiculously expensive, or impossible to obtain, the usage of firearms will dwindle until there's little resistance to legislative gun control measures in government.
In the mid 80's many ammunition manufacturers changed shotgun pellets over to steel to help with lead ingestion in waterfowl. An area where I could see a lead in the environment issue, based on the number of shotgun pellets raining down on my head at any time while out on many duck hunts. The lead pellets would settle down to the bottom of the ponds and streams where the waterfowl would ingest it while searching for food off the bottom. As far as spent bullets causing lead toxicity in wildlife, I don't see this as a big problem because the lead is not abundant in the wildlife's food sources like it was for the waterfowl.
I believe the AZFGD says it best here, "Arizona Game and Fish Department urges caution in the rush to judgment in the proposal to ban lead ammunition and fishing tackle nationally."
